Choosing the right Cartier band in 2026 comes down to a few fundamentals. Metal first: yellow gold is having a real moment again, with a warm tone that flatters most skin. Rose gold leans soft and romantic, while white metals (white gold or platinum) feel cool and modern. If you live hard on your hands, platinum’s density and natural white color are practical perks; it will scratch, but it tends to develop a handsome patina rather than losing metal through polishing. White gold’s brightness is great, too — just remember it is typically rhodium-finished, so occasional replating may be part of upkeep.

The control layer is where car gates quietly become delightful. At the basic end, you have remotes, keypads, and intercoms. Step up a notch and you get app-based access, so you can buzz in a friend from anywhere or create a one-time PIN for a contractor. Schedules are handy too: keep gates open during school pickup windows or lock them down after hours. If you manage a multi-tenant garage, temporary codes that expire automatically are a lifesaver for cleanup and event crews.
Any moving gate can be dangerous if it is not installed and maintained with safety in mind. Look for safety edges, photo eyes, and obstruction sensing built into your operators. These stop or reverse the gate when they detect a person, vehicle, or debris. If kids play nearby or the public can reach the gate, these are not optional extras—they are the baseline. In snowy or dusty climates, plan for regular checks to keep sensors clean and responsive.
